I’m trying to create a table in my database through C# using the following method:

    private static void CreateTables()
    {
        _commandtext = "CREATE TABLE Users(" +
                        "ID Integer PRIMARY KEY, " +
                        "Username Text(20), " +
                        "Password Text(25), " +
                        "IBAN Text(18)" +
                        ");";
        _command = new OleDbCommand(_commandtext, _connection);

        _connection.Open();

        int number = _command.ExecuteNonQuery();  <<< Error

        _connection.Close();
    }

Somehow it returns an error: “Syntaxerror in fielddefinition”
What am I doing wrong?

Edit: Solved but nevertheless: I’m using this for Access

    Have you tried adding square brackets around your names?

    private static void CreateTables()
    {
        _commandtext = "CREATE TABLE [Users](" +
                        "[ID] Integer PRIMARY KEY, " +
                        "[Username] Text(20), " +
                        "[Password] Text(25), " +
                        "[IBAN] Text(18)" +
                        ");";
        _command = new OleDbCommand(_commandtext, _connection);
    
        _connection.Open();
    
        int number = _command.ExecuteNonQuery();  <<< Error
    
        _connection.Close();
    }
    

    Maybe your DB thinks you’re referencing other fields instead of creating new ones with the names you put in.
